Raymond J. Fisher Middle is a public middle school that is part of the Los Gatos Union Elementary school district, located in Los Gatos, CA with about 1,288 students offering grade levels from 6th Grade to 8th Grade. Student demographics can be found below. With about 60 teachers, Raymond J. Fisher Middle has a student/teacher ratio of about 21:1. The national average for public schools is about 15:1. A lower student/teacher ratio is a key factor that determines how much a teacher can devote his/her time to each individual student thus improving, or reducing (in the event of a higher student/teacher ratio) the attention each student is given for their educational needs.
